Vertical disconnectors are pivotal in electric systems, providing a reputable means of isolating an area or detaching of the network for maintenance or in instance of faults. Their vertical setup permits them to be space-efficient, especially valuable in overloaded installments. These disconnectors offer noticeable break and guarantee safety and security during upkeep by eliminating any type of power circulation through the detached area. In high-voltage (HV) applications, they must hold up against significant electric stresses and environmental problems, making robust style and making quality necessary.

The fuse switch disconnector merges the functionality of a switch and a fuse, giving both overload defense and the ability to separate the electric circuit manually. By combining overcurrent defense with a hand-operated switch, these gadgets ensure that critical systems are shielded without compromising user control over the electric circuit.

An isolator switch, although it might seem comparable, offers a slightly various function. While it also disconnects a section of the circuit for security during upkeep, it does not provide defense from overcurrent like fuse switch disconnectors. Isolator switches are usually made use of downstream of a circuit breaker and supply a safe ways to isolate devices or circuits for maintenance, making certain that no current can flow. The key role of an isolator is to make certain that segments of an electric installment are risk-free to work with; thus, they are usually used in industrial installments where machine security is essential.

A busbar system, meanwhile, is a central structure for distributing electric power. It functions as a central center for several circuits and tons, streamlining the distribution of electrical power within a center.

Surge protective gadgets (SPDs) play a basic role in securing electrical installments from transient voltage spikes, such as those created by lightning strikes or changing events. These tools are important for shielding sensitive electronic tools and broader electrical installments from surges that can create significant damage, information loss, or perhaps fires. SPDs work by drawing away excess voltage to the ground and keeping a secure level of current in the circuit, thus securing linked tools. Increasingly, the unification of SPDs is deemed crucial in both commercial and property electric systems, specifically with the increasing dependence on sensitive electronics.

In renewable resource systems, such as solar power installations, the combiner box holds substantial value. It aggregates multiple inputs from photovoltaic panel strings into a solitary output, which is then routed to inverters. This combination is crucial for streamlining monitoring and maintenance within solar photovoltaic or pv systems. Combiner boxes often come outfitted with their very own surge security devices and monitoring systems, which make sure that any kind of anomalies in power generation are quickly recognized and attended to. They play here an important role in boosting the dependability and efficiency of solar energy systems by optimizing power collection and circulation.
